Muscle pain after a leg cramp, a condition that is mainly due to the violent contraction of the muscle during the cramp, resulting in a slight strain of the muscle fibers inside the muscle, will stimulate the peripheral nerves. It is also possible that inflammatory edema will form locally, which will stimulate the peripheral nerves and cause pain in the muscle area. The following measures should be taken after this situation: First, it is important to keep the muscles fully relaxed and to keep them warm, otherwise there is a risk of re-inducing pain in the muscles. Because muscle fatigue can produce inflammation, and after the muscle has been cooled, it will cause the muscle tissue to become more tense, which will induce muscle cramps when the muscle is exerted. Second, to do a good job of keeping the leg muscles warm, you can apply warm water bags for hot compresses to increase blood circulation in the muscle area, increase arterial blood supply, promote venous reflux, reduce local inflammatory lesions, reduce inflammatory metabolites and lactic acid, etc., can effectively prevent muscle cramps again, and can relieve muscle pain.
